The rest area part is well used and with large shaded picnic area. The N Idaho bicycle trail goes through it so it also has a lot of bicycle racks . Actually I give that part a 4 1/2z. However there is no visitor info or welcome center and that is why I stopped.I missed the weigh station turn and went around thru construction to come back. Empty building. Nothing to say where else to go for info. No literature about places to eat, camp, stay etc There was a faded id map I could not read.

Nice clean restrooms with a weigh station and tourist manned tourist information booth for Idaho & Montana. Big bonus was the paved Centennial trail goes across the back of the rest stop. Took a nice walk on a beautiful day. Nice break from driving. Tempted to take a ride too.
